Compensation:
It is the process of providing adequate, equitable and fair remuneration to the employees. It includes:
Job evaluation:
It is the process of determining relative worth of jobs.
Wage and salary Administration:
This is the process of developing and operating a suitable wage and salary programme.
Incentives:
It is the process of formulating, administering and reviewing the schemes of financial incentives in addition to regular payment of wages and salary.
Bonus:
It includes payment of statutory bonus according to the Payment of Bonus Act, 1965 and its latest amendments.
Fringe benefits :
These are the various benefits at the fringe of the wage. Management provides these to motivate the employee and to meet their life’s contingencies.
Social security measures:
Managements provide social security to their employees in addition to the fringe benefits.
